Simplified | Traditional | Pinyin | English |
---|---|---|---|
吃水 | 吃水 | chīshuǐ | - drinking water - to obtain water (for daily needs) - to absorb water - draft (of ship) |
吃水不忘挖井人 | 吃水不忘挖井人 | chīshuǐbùwàngwājǐngrén | - see 吃水不忘掘井人[chi1 shui3 bu4 wang4 jue2 jing3 ren2] |
吃水不忘掘井人 | 吃水不忘掘井人 | chīshuǐbùwàngjuéjǐngrén | - Drinking the water of a well, one should never forget who dug it. (idiom) |
靠山吃山,靠水吃水 | 靠山吃山,靠水吃水 | kàoshānchīshān,kàoshuǐchīshuǐ | - lit. the mountain dweller lives off the mountain, the shore dweller lives off the sea (idiom) - fig. to make the best use of local resources - to exploit one's position to advance oneself - to find one's niche - to live off the land |
